Your First 10 Minutes with Job Interview Questions: JD-Based Interview Prep Made Easy
Are You Tired of Generic Interview Prep? I Was Too. 😩

If you’re anything like me, you’ve spent hours Googling "common interview questions for a Senior Developer" or "behavioral questions for a Project Manager." You end up with massive lists of generic questions that barely scratch the surface of the actual role you’re applying for. It’s frustrating, time-consuming, and frankly, ineffective. You need practice tailored to that specific job description (JD), not some universal list.
That feeling of needing hyper-specific preparation led me, as an indie developer, to build something better. I wanted a tool that understood the nuances of a JD and could instantly generate relevant, targeted practice. That's why I built Job Interview Questions, an AI interview coach designed to cut through the noise. I recently launched Job Interview Questions, and I want to walk you through exactly how you can get your first "aha!" moment in under ten minutes.
What is Job Interview Questions and Why I Built It
Job Interview Questions is your personal, AI-powered interview coach, specifically focused on JD-based preparation. The core problem it solves is the disconnect between general interview practice and the actual requirements of the job you want. Most coaching is too broad; my tool is laser-focused.
Here’s the elevator pitch: Paste any English job description into the platform, and Job Interview Questions instantly parses the role requirements. From that JD, it generates 8 highly tailored questions covering technical skills, behavioral fit, and situational judgment. It’s designed for fast, effective practice for anyone applying to knowledge-work or tech roles globally.
Why did I build this? Because standard interview prep often feels like studying for the wrong exam. I wanted candidates to walk into an interview knowing they’ve practiced the exact type of questions the hiring manager is likely to ask, based directly on the job description they posted. It’s about efficiency and relevance. You can find the tool live at https://www.jobinterviewquestions.app/.
Your First Quick Win: JD-Based Question Generation
The real magic of Job Interview Questions happens when you input your target JD. Let’s walk through your first session, focusing on speed and relevance.
Step 1: Paste Your JD
Find the job description for the role you are targeting. Copy the entire text—from the role title down to the required skills. Head over to the platform and paste it into the input box. That's it for setup. No complex configurations, no signing up for endless modules.
Step 2: Instant Tailoring (The "Aha!" Moment) 💡
Hit 'Generate Questions.' Within seconds, the AI analyzes the text. If the JD heavily emphasizes "experience with cloud-native microservices using Go," you won't get generic Java questions. You’ll get specific questions about Go concurrency models or deployment strategies in Kubernetes.
Example of what you might see generated:
- Technical: "Describe a time you had to debug a race condition in a high-throughput Go service. What tools did you use?"
- Behavioral: "This role requires cross-functional leadership. Tell us about a project where you had to align engineering priorities with product roadmap goals."
This immediate specificity is what separates Job Interview Questions from generic practice tools. It’s built to be JD-based interview preparation.
Beyond Questions: Getting Actionable Feedback

Generating questions is only half the battle. The real value of Job Interview Questions lies in the immediate, targeted feedback you receive after you practice answering. This is where you iterate and improve fast.
Practice Answering and Scoring
For each of the 8 questions, you input your answer. The AI then provides two crucial things:
- A Per-Question Score: This gives you an objective measure of how well you addressed the core requirements of that specific question.
- Strengths and Weaknesses Highlighting: This is where the coaching kicks in. The AI doesn't just say "good job"; it points out why your answer scored that way.
If you mentioned using a specific framework but failed to explain why you chose it over an alternative, the feedback might look like this:
Feedback Snippet: Strength: Clearly articulated the steps taken. Weakness: Lacked justification for the architectural choice (e.g., why Kafka over RabbitMQ for this specific scenario). Next Step: Ensure you always back up technical decisions with comparative reasoning.
This concrete advice is invaluable. It tells you exactly what needs fixing before the real interview. In Job Interview Questions, I implemented this detailed scoring system because I believe feedback must be actionable, not just encouraging.
Consolidating Your Learning: The Final Report
After running through all 8 questions and receiving individual feedback, the session culminates in a Consolidated Report. This feature is designed for tracking progress and identifying patterns.
Imagine you run three different sessions for three different roles this week. The final report from Job Interview Questions will synthesize your performance across all attempts, highlighting:
- Overall Score Trend: Are you improving session over session?
- Recurring Weaknesses: If the AI keeps flagging a lack of detail in your situational answers, you know exactly what to focus on in your next round of prep.
- Key Strengths: What are you consistently nailing? Use this to build confidence.
- Recommended Next Steps: A summary of the top 2-3 areas needing immediate attention.
This holistic view moves you beyond isolated practice into strategic career development. This is what makes Job Interview Questions an affordable alternative to expensive human coaching—you get the targeted analysis without the hourly rate.
Use Cases: When Should You Fire Up Job Interview Questions? 🚀
This tool shines in specific scenarios where generic prep fails. Here are a few ways candidates are already using it:
1. Preparing for an Overseas Role (English Practice)
If you are applying for roles in English-speaking markets but English is your second language, practicing the content while simultaneously ensuring your delivery is professional is tough. Job Interview Questions allows you to focus purely on crafting high-quality, technical answers in English, knowing the AI is evaluating both content and clarity.
2. Identifying Hidden Gaps in Competitive Tech Roles
Startup and competitive tech roles often test niche skills mentioned briefly in the JD. By pasting that JD, you force the AI to generate questions based on those niche requirements. If you struggle to answer a question about "eventual consistency" when the JD only mentioned "database design," you've identified a critical gap before the interview.
3. Iterative Practice
Maybe you bombed your first attempt at answering a difficult system design question. In Job Interview Questions, you can revise your answer immediately, resubmit it, and see if the feedback improves. This rapid iteration loop is fantastic for cementing complex concepts.
A Word from the Developer: Honesty About the Journey

As an indie dev, I’m thrilled with how accurately the AI models can parse complex, jargon-filled JDs. That was the biggest technical hurdle—making sure the context extraction was robust. However, I want to be clear: this is an AI coach, not a human psychologist. It’s exceptional at assessing technical alignment and structural quality of answers, but it won't detect your nervousness or body language. It’s a perfect supplement, designed to get you 90% of the way there with targeted practice.
Frequently Asked Questions About Job Interview Questions
Q: Does Job Interview Questions work for non-tech roles? A: While heavily optimized for tech and knowledge work (due to the technical nature of the parsing), it works well for any role description that relies on specific skills, processes, or management requirements. Just paste the JD!
Q: Is my pasted job description kept private? A: Absolutely. Privacy is paramount. The data is used solely for the current session to generate your tailored questions and feedback, adhering strictly to standard privacy practices.
Q: How many sessions can I run? A: Check the current subscription tiers on the website, but the goal is to allow candidates to run multiple quick sessions to track progress over time affordably.
Ready to Ace Your Next Interview?
Stop wasting time on generic interview guides. Your next role requires specific preparation, and Job Interview Questions delivers exactly that. Experience the power of JD-based AI coaching tailored precisely to your target job.
Ready to see the difference targeted practice makes? Try Job Interview Questions today and transform how you prepare for your next big opportunity! Good luck! 👍